The First Casualty of Hillary Clinton's Server

WASHINGTON -- Exactly how damaging the classified information that was discovered on Hillary Clinton's server is became clear this weekend, when the Iranian government executed an alleged spy. He had been mentioned in at least one email from an aide to then-Secretary of State Clinton, who called him "our friend."

The man was nuclear scientist Shahram Amiri, who was executed for allegedly passing on information to the United States. Amiri had been in and out of the news since 2009, when he first defected from Iran, eventually turning up on our shores. After a series of contradictory appearances on YouTube and in other videos in which he repeatedly changed his mind about residence in America, he returned home to be with his family. Then, in 2010, he disappeared, presumably was put under arrest and ultimately, according to Iranian government spokesman Gholam Hossein Mohseni Ejei, "was hanged for revealing the country's top secrets to the enemy." That would be the United States, the West's preeminent force in agreeing to President Barack Obama's reckless nuclear deal with Iran. The Iranian government calls us "the enemy."
